Catching water damage early can save you a lot of money and prevent more serious problems. Ignoring subtle signs can lead to extensive damage that costs much more to fix. It’s important to know what to look for around your property.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ent damp, musty smell, especially in basements or bathrooms, is a strong indicator of hidden moisture. This is often the first sign of mold growth beginning behind walls or under floors. Investigating strange odors is critical.

Visible Water Stains or Discoloration

Look for dark or yellowish stains on ceilings, walls, or even furniture. These marks mean water has been present, even if it has since dried. They can indicate a past leak or an ongoing issue. Addressing visible stains prevents further damage.

Peeling or Bubbling Paint and Wallpaper

When paint or wallpaper starts to peel away from the wall, especially in patches, moisture is likely trapped behind it. The adhesive is failing due to the dampness. Noticing peeling paint could signal a hidden problem.

Warped or Buckling Flooring

Hardwood floors can warp, and laminate or vinyl flooring can buckle when exposed to excess moisture. If your floors feel soft, spongy, or uneven, water is the probable cause. Checking for warped floors is a smart move.

Increased Humidity Levels

If your home feels unusually damp or humid, even when the air conditioning is running, there might be a water issue. High humidity can lead to condensation and further damage. Monitoring indoor humidity helps detect problems.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Any visible signs of mold, even small patches of black, green, or white fuzzy growth, mean there’s been enough moisture to support it. Mold can spread rapidly and pose health risks. Identifying early mold is vital.

Water Damage Restoration Cost Estimate v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small spill on hard flooring (e.g., tile) Yes No Easy to clean up with towels and fans.
Minor leak from a faucet or pipe, contained to a small area Maybe Yes Risk of hidden damage behind walls or under floors.
Water damage affecting drywall or plaster No Yes Requires specialized drying equipment and potential material replacement.
Saturated carpet and padding Maybe Yes Difficult to dry completely without professional equipment, leading to mold.
Water damage in a finished basement No Yes Complex environment with high risk of structural and mold damage.
Sewage or contaminated water backup Absolutely Not Yes Serious health hazard requiring specialized cleanup and remediation.

For anything beyond a minor, easily managed spill, calling a professional for water damage restoration is usually the safest and most effective route. Professional assessment prevents costly mistakes, and our team is equipped to handle complex drying and restoration.

Water Damage Restoration Cost Estimate Cost In Tuscano, AZ

The cost of water damage restoration can vary significantly depending on several factors. These include the type of water (clean, gray, or black water), the amount of water, the size of the affected area, and the materials damaged. Our estimates in Tuscano, AZ aim to be as precise as possible after an initial assessment.

Service Aspect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$300 – $1,500 Volume of water, accessibility of the area.
Structural Drying (Air Movers & Dehumidifiers) $500 – $3,000+ Square footage, duration of drying needed, complexity of the space.
Mold Remediation (if necessary) $750 – $4,000+ Severity of mold growth, containment needs, square footage affected.
Damaged Material Removal (Drywall, Insulation) $200 – $1,000+ per room Amount of material to be removed, disposal fees.
Carpet and Flooring Restoration/Replacement $500 – $5,000+ Type of flooring, extent of damage, need for replacement vs. cleaning.
Initial Inspection and Estimate Free Often waived if services are hired, but covers technician time and assessment.

Remember, these are just general ranges. A precise quote requires a site visit from our trained technicians. We offer free, no-obligation estimates to give you a clear picture.

Common Questions About Water Damage Restoration Cost Estimate

How much does water damage restoration cost?

The cost varies widely based on the severity and extent of the damage. Factors like the amount of water, the type of water (clean, gray, or black), and the affected materials all play a role. Our detailed estimates break down all costs clearly so you know exactly what you’re paying for.

Will my homeowner’s insurance cover water damage restoration costs?

Often, yes, especially if the damage is sudden and accidental, like from a burst pipe. However, coverage for slow leaks or flood damage can differ. Contacting your insurance provider early is recommended, and we can help document the damage for your claim.

How quickly do I need to address water damage?

You need to act fast. Within 24-48 hours, mold can begin to grow, and structural damage can worsen significantly. The sooner we can start the drying and restoration process, the less damage there will be and the lower the overall cost.

What kind of equipment do you use for water damage restoration?

We use professional-grade equipment, including powerful water extractors, industrial air movers, specialized dehumidifiers, and moisture meters. Advanced drying technology is essential for thoroughly removing moisture from all affected materials. Our technicians are trained to use this equipment effectively.

Can I prevent water damage in my home?

While not all water damage is preventable, you can reduce the risk by regularly inspecting pipes and appliances, maintaining your roof and gutters, and addressing small leaks promptly. Proactive home maintenance can save you from costly repairs.
